Always search for quotes and compare them from various local installers. This will help you compare prices and find the most value for your money. You can use an online tool to compare prices and determine how much you can save if you switch suppliers.
The price of uPVC double glazed windows can differ based on the design, material and size you choose. Fixed windows, for instance are not able to open and cost between PS150 to PS300 per window (excluding installation). Sliding windows are horizontally arranged on one or more sides to open, and can be more expensive at PS450 to PS1000.

The first step is to gather estimates from national and local window installers. Ask them for the details of their warranties for their products, guarantee, and insurance documents. Find a company that has been operating for a long time. This is a mark of professionalism and trustworthiness.
You should also ask about the cost of labour. Many window companies subcontract their installation to local fitters. This can add to the total cost. Also, you should inquire whether they offer a financing scheme.
Many local and national windows firms have a range of schemes available to help lower the cost of installing double glazing at your home. The ECO4 grant and LA Flex are two of the schemes that are available. The ECO4 scheme is designed to help homeowners on lower incomes afford energy-saving improvements, including double glazing. LA Flex provides financial assistance to those who don't meet the ECO4 requirements.

In addition to standard double glazing, you can also get triple-glazed windows that offer a higher level of insulation and noise reduction. This type of window has an additional glass that is insulated by an inert gas, such as argon or Krypton which prevents heat loss. Additionally you can select from a variety of coatings to further improve the insulation.
Double-glazed windows made of aluminium are another option. They have a slimmer and sleeker frame. These windows are extremely durable and weather-resistant, and they can be designed to match your home's style. They also come in a variety of shades that will fit your preferences. They are more expensive than uPVC but they could save you money in the long term.
Timber double-glazed windows are also a popular choice. They are made of sustainable wood and are more sustainable than uPVC. These windows are available in a range of styles, from bay to sash and can be stained or painted to fit your home's style.
